Religijność sztuki. Simone Weil aesthetica crucis
The author reconstructs Simone Weil’s aesthetica crucis. Questions supposed to be specific to the aesthetics or the art philosophy in Simone Weil’s thought are undertaken as the most fundamental questions about origins and boundaries of human being. The concept of beauty is inherent to her theological, eschatologal, or metaethical insights, for the beauty and its experience is related to the very essence of reality and human condition: The Cross (contradictions, antinomies, oppositions as the suffering/affliction).
